Whilst previous recordings have been DIY productions, Santiago felt this album deserved studio time and attention to capture his new enlarged sound. Recalling a chance conversation with Mauro Pawlowski (Evil Superstars, dEUS) a few years ago in which Pawlowski stated Pascal Deweze (Metal Molly, Sukilove) was “his main man with the right studio”, Santiago sent his demos to Studio Jezus. Deweze liked the demos and between them they managed to enlist the very best Belgian and Dutch musicians to record the album, including Jezus Factory label mates Dave Schroyen (Evil Superstars, Millionaire, Creature with the Atom Brain) and Chantal Acda (True Bypass, Sleeping Dog). All these fantastic artists also feature on the album artwork.
